Virgin boss enters marine mammal controversy

February 2014: Virgin Holidays has responded positively to a campaign by Whale and Dolphin Conservation (WDC) asking holiday companies to stop offering trips to see captive whales and dolphins.

Virgin has vowed not to promote any tourist attractions that will take marine animals from the sea. “I’ve instructed Virgin Holidays not to deal with any organisation that does not pledge that they will never again take cetaceans from the sea," says Sir Richard Branson. “We hope other holiday companies will follow suit. Since – I believe – animals bred in captivity cannot safely be released, we will examine what is best to do with this issue, and others, in the engagement process. As part of the process I will personally visit some of these facilities around the world."
